Output e20dbdcdfa9cd7eb25a43a7d9dbc0e1709ce5a5fbdaa1773efdc463a55335f67:2

value
28703495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 125bcacb206ed107ff2146e9dca22e9aaf9a9e83 OP_EQUAL
address
33N63pyPuUZEAsfaQ53Q23D7TGLu15jXoy
transaction
e20dbdcdfa9cd7eb25a43a7d9dbc0e1709ce5a5fbdaa1773efdc463a55335f67
spent
true